How to Choose a Cheap and High-Quality Kitchen Sink
The most affordable sinks today are stainless steel and pushed steel. The reduced price stainless and also the pressed steel are also called "apartment" grade. They call them this because home proprietors, trying to find the cheapest costs often tend to utilize these items. If you're on a budget as well as your family are not heavy users of the kitchen area sink, these might be an attractive choice to much more expensive materials. Realize though that journalism steel sink generally has actually a repainted surface that scrapes as well as chips easily. These sinks will certainly tend to look old as well as out-of-date swiftly due to the finish used. The stainless also scrapes quickly yet if looked after appropriately, it will certainly remain to look acceptable. Cheaper stainless-steel sinks often tend to be made of thinner product which means that water being encountered them and the garbage disposal will certainly seem a great deal louder on these less expensive models. These sinks come in rimless and leading installed models.

A certain upgrade to these items is the cast iron kitchen area sink. These sinks are made from casted metal them completed with a porcelain material providing a deep and gorgeous radiance. The surface is long using as well as with a little occasional waxing, can look great for several years. They can be found in a variety of shades and can be bought in undercounter placing or leading mounting designs. These kitchen area sinks however are heavy and a lot more tough to install so unless you are extremely convenient as well as have experience with these sinks, you will need an expert for setup.

An additional sink material that seems to be acquiring in popularity is the solid surface kind material These are a resilient product created into a kitchen sink as well as tend to be more of a matte surface. This kind of sink product goes especially well with more natural finishes in your kitchen area. Although not as prominent as cast-iron, these composite kitchen area sinks are rapidly acquiring a solid following.

Choosing the Perfect Sink Size


In some cases, the size of your sink is often a personal preference. In other cases, it is based on your area’s available space. You would not want to purchase a 36-inch sink when your kitchen has very limited space. Another thing to contemplate is making sure you consider reserving space on both sides of your sink. You can make use of the space for prepping food, stacking unwashed dishes, and even placing newly washed dishes. Think about what you favor most and based on your likes and dislikes you can choose the perfect size sink.


Kitchen Size


The telling factor of how large or small your sink will need to be is based on the overall size of your kitchen. A small kitchen has a large sink means less countertop space. A great rule of thumb that contractors tend to use is that kitchens up to 150 square feet can handle up to a 24-inch wide sink. Make sure your sink is proportionate to your kitchen layout.
